Irmgard L. Wilson, 78, of Kenosha, passed away Friday, July 21st, 2006, at Brookside Care Center. Born in Kenosha on April 18, 1928, she was the daughter of the late Robert and Elly (Ermert) Ruebsamen. A lifelong resident of Kenosha, she attended Friedens Evangelical Lutheran School, Milwaukee Lutheran High School and Gateway Technical College where she received her degree in library science. On January 11, 1947, she married Robert J. Wilson at Friedens Evangelical Lutheran Church. She had been employed as a library technical assistant at the Kenosha Unified Schools, Instructional Media Center for 29 years, retiring in 1997. She was a member of Bethany Lutheran Church where she also taught Sunday school for many years. Surviving are her husband Robert of Kenosha; a son, Scott (Janine) Wilson of Kenosha; a daughter, Suzanne (Jeffrey) Mohr of Pleasant Prairie; a sister, Anita Lupi of Kenosha; two grandchildren, Eric and Emily Mohr; and also her sister-in-law, Isabelle (Dr. Glenn) Bacon of Harlingen, TX.
